Eyes fearful, paws worn
A sorrowful sight
So forlorn
Love they said would be the cure
For the suffering
You had to endure
So our family grew that day
We brought you home
With us you'd stay
Slowly, gently the bond it grew
Faithful, loyal
Looking back it's so unclear
How we got by
Without you here
Trusted companion, devoted friend
You give and give
It never ends
They said we were a gift to you
But now we know
Who rescued who
(J. M. Berry)
